Most of what passes for data destruction inside an organization removes the pointer to the data and leaves the data itself sitting on the platter. The gap between those two things is where breach notifications come from.
A quick format rewrites the file table, not the blocks. Free recovery tools pull the contents back in minutes.

Wear levelling means a multi-pass overwrite never reaches the spare blocks. Flash needs a purge command or destruction, not a scrub.

The failure mode is rarely the technique. It's the missing paperwork: no serial list, no method on record, no signature. If you can't evidence destruction, you can't evidence it didn't leak.
NIST SP 800-88 Rev. 1 draws the line between Clear, Purge and Destroy. We pick per media type and per your risk appetite, and the method we used goes on the certificate against the serial number.

On self-encrypting drives and modern encrypted endpoints, destroying the key destroys the data. Fast, verifiable, and the only sound approach on flash that was encrypted from first use.

If it stores a byte, it goes on the inventory. Below is how each class is normally treated — your policy overrides ours on any line.
| Media | Default method | Why |
|---|---|---|
| Hard disk drives (HDD) | Purge, or shred on request | Overwrite reaches every addressable block on magnetic media and the drive keeps its resale value. |
| SSD, NVMe and M.2 | Cryptographic erase or sanitize command | Wear levelling hides spare blocks from an overwrite. Flash needs a firmware-level purge. |
| Phones and tablets | Purge, with lock and activation checks | Encrypted by default, so key destruction plus a verified factory state clears the device. |
| Laptops, desktops and workstations | Purge in place, drive pulled on request | Keeps the machine whole and remarketable, which is where your return comes from. |
| Servers, RAID arrays and SAN | Per-drive purge after array break-down | Controller-level wipes miss drives that dropped out of the array before you retired it. |
| Backup tape (LTO, DLT) | Destroy | Sequential media can't be verified block by block, and tape rarely has residual value. |
| USB sticks, SD and CF cards | Destroy | Low value, high risk, and controller quirks make verification unreliable at volume. |
| Optical discs | Destroy | Write-once media cannot be overwritten at all. |
| Printers, MFPs and network gear | Purge of the internal drive or NVRAM | The forgotten category. Copiers hold years of scanned documents on an internal disk. |

The part that matters for data destruction is the scope. Ours explicitly covers logical data sanitization and downstream vendor management — meaning both the work we do ourselves and the partners who destroy what we can't sanitize are inside the audit, and get re-audited every year.
